Netflix is a digital streaming service that has won itself a legion of loyal fans through airing shows like Stranger Things and Breaking Bad. However, it has also become popular because of the way it ...
Geek Life: Fun stories, memes, humor and other random items at the intersection of tech, science, business and culture. SEE MORE by Molly Brown on Sep 29, 2015 at 9:28 am September 29, 2015 at 9:31 am ...
Mobile video is taking off, especially due to high-quality video streams available over increasingly fast LTE mobile networks. The only problem is that most users have wireless plans that include a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results